Agathe Rachel Nnindjem is a basketball player born on August 04, 1980 in Yaoundé. Her height is six foot three (1m90 / 6-3). She is a center who most recently played for Toulouse in France - LFB Challenge Round (W).

Agathe Nnindjem - Points
Agathe Nnindjem scores a career high 27 points (2004)
On October 20, 2004, Agathe Nnindjem tied her career high in points in a Spain - LF Endesa (W) game. That day she scored 27 points in Burgos's road loss against Ros Casares, 71-53. She also had 11 rebounds, 1 assist, 3 steals and 1 block. She shot 13/17 from two, shooting at 76.5% from the field. She also shot 1/3 from the free-throw line.
